Silver Lake, IN vs Wingate, IN
There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Wingate is 26% cheaper than Silver Lake. With a cost index of 58 vs 73,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Wingate to Silver Lake should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.
On the housing front, median rent in Silver Lake is $1,057/month compared to $638/month in Wingate — a 66%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Wingate is more affordable at $77,500 median vs $107,300.
Median household income in Silver Lake is $53,542 compared to $62,019 in Wingate (-13.7%). Wingate off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power. Looking at affordability, residents of Silver Lake spend roughly 23.7% of their income on rent, more than the 12.3% in Wingate.
